- The distance between Ouallene Bordj, Algeria and Matad, Mongolia is approximately 9,689 km or 6,021 mi.
- To reach Ouallene Bordj in this distance one would set out from Matad bearing 304°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Ouallene Bordj bearing 218.3° or SW .
- Ouallene Bordj has a subtropical hot desert climate (BWh) whereas Matad has a mid-latitude cool steppe climate (BSk).
- Ouallene Bordj is in or near the tropical desert biome whereas Matad is in or near the boreal dry scrub biome.
- The average temperature is 27.1 °C (48.8°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 19.3 °C (34.7°F) less in Ouallene Bordj.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to truly continental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 171 mm (6.7 in) less which is equivalent to 171 l/m² (4.2 US gal/ft²) or 1,710,000 l/ha (182,810 US gal/ac) less. About 0 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 22.4° higher in Ouallene Bordj than in Matad.
